Guatemalan Catholics celebrate the Virgen de la Candelaria on February 2, the date that symbolizes the presentation of Jesus Christ in the Temple and the purification of the Virgin Mary. Mobilizations are held in several villages, but they are most notable in Guatemala City, where, in addition to the mass and prayers in the Candelaria church, a procession takes place in the old parts of the city. Imported by the Spaniards, this custom would come from Tenerife specifically, in the Canary Islands.
